Transaction

e154fa7d9a1e3da3a84f66d9e234ee3a7c4e4507014fce0fdeb6d2fc7e9dc80e
449,751 confirmations
Timestamp
1505439574
Block485,310
Fee13,560 sats
Fee rate60.3 sats/vB
view on mempool.space

Inputs & Outputs